Indholdsfortegnelse:
- Forbrugsvarer
- Trin 1: Passo 1: Criar Um Novo Projeto Ingen Google Firebase
- Trin 2: Passo 2: Populær som oplysninger om realtidsdatabase
- Trin 3: Passo 3: Criando O Aplicativo Android
- Trin 4: Passo 4: Configurando O Aplicativo Android Para Firebase
- Trin 5: Passo 5: Realizando a Conexão Do Aplicativo Com O Firebase
- Trin 6: Passo 6: Montando O Circuito De Detecção De Luz
- Trin 7: Passo 7: Envio Das Informações Para O Firebase
- Trin 8: Passo 8: Teste Final
![Sensor De Luz Online: 8 trin Sensor De Luz Online: 8 trin](https://i.howwhatproduce.com/images/001/image-2926-62-j.webp)
Video: Sensor De Luz Online: 8 trin
![Video: Sensor De Luz Online: 8 trin Video: Sensor De Luz Online: 8 trin](https://i.ytimg.com/vi/_2i3Ev1zn_8/hqdefault.jpg)
2024 Forfatter: John Day | [email protected]. Sidst ændret: 2024-01-30 08:27
![Sensor De Luz Online Sensor De Luz Online](https://i.howwhatproduce.com/images/001/image-2926-63-j.webp)
Projeto de um Sensor de Luz que avisa para o celular se a luz está acesa ou não
Pode ser usado como forma de segurança ou alerta para economia de energia
Forbrugsvarer
Para realizar esse projeto é needsário:
- Uma placa ESP8266
- Uma PROTOBOARD pequena
- Um cabo mikro USB
- Um Resistor sensível à luz que servirá como nosso sensor de iluminação
- Um modstand på 10K ohm
- Fios para ligação (Jumper Wires)
-
IDE'er
- Android Studio
- Arduino IDE
Trin 1: Passo 1: Criar Um Novo Projeto Ingen Google Firebase
![Passo 1: Criar Um Novo Projeto Ingen Google Firebase Passo 1: Criar Um Novo Projeto Ingen Google Firebase](https://i.howwhatproduce.com/images/001/image-2926-64-j.webp)
- Entrar em console.firebase.google.com
- Klik på Adicionar Projeto
- Seguir som instruktioner til Android
Trin 2: Passo 2: Populær som oplysninger om realtidsdatabase
![Passo 2: Populær som oplysninger om realtidsdatabase Passo 2: Populær som oplysninger om realtidsdatabase](https://i.howwhatproduce.com/images/001/image-2926-65-j.webp)
- Klik på Database no painel lateral do firebase
- Læs mere om realtime database i overensstemmelse med figurer
- Anote em algum lugar a url do banco de dados (termina com.firebaseio.com)
Trin 3: Passo 3: Criando O Aplicativo Android
![Passo 3: Criando O Aplicativo til Android Passo 3: Criando O Aplicativo til Android](https://i.howwhatproduce.com/images/001/image-2926-66-j.webp)
- Entre no Android Studio
- Klik på File -> Nyt projekt
- Escolha a Opção Tom aktivitet
- Crie um novo aplicativo Android com as informações da figura
Trin 4: Passo 4: Configurando O Aplicativo Android Para Firebase
-
Ingen arquivo build.gradle til PROJETO, insira a linha dentro da seção de dependências
classpath 'com.google.gms: google-services: 4.3.2'
-
Ingen arquivo build.gradle til modul APP, insira og linha dentro da seção de dependências
implementering 'com.google.firebase: firebase-database: 19.1.0'
Trin 5: Passo 5: Realizando a Conexão Do Aplicativo Com O Firebase
- Abra o arquivo Hovedaktivitet
-
Substitua o conteúdo pelo conteúdo abaixo
Conteúdo MainActivity
Desta forma o aplicativo já estará escutando alterações no firebase.
Você já pode executar o aplicativo e testar as alterações no seu celular.
Trin 6: Passo 6: Montando O Circuito De Detecção De Luz
![Passo 6: Montando O Circuito De Detecção De Luz Passo 6: Montando O Circuito De Detecção De Luz](https://i.howwhatproduce.com/images/001/image-2926-67-j.webp)
Monte o circuito conforme a imagem
Trin 7: Passo 7: Envio Das Informações Para O Firebase
![Passo 7: Envio Das Informações Para O Firebase Passo 7: Envio Das Informações Para O Firebase](https://i.howwhatproduce.com/images/001/image-2926-68-j.webp)
-
Abra a IDE nativa do Arduino e crie um novo arquivo em File -> Ny
De o nome que quiser ao arquivo
- Remova qualquer conteúdo predefinido
-
Cole o seguinte tekst
Arquivo de Configuração do Arduino (ESP8266)
Anbefalede:
Online vejrstation: 6 trin
![Online vejrstation: 6 trin Online vejrstation: 6 trin](https://i.howwhatproduce.com/images/002/image-4992-j.webp)
Online vejrstation: Du vil ikke tro det! Men fra begyndelsen. Jeg arbejdede på den næste version af CoolPhone og antallet af fejl, jeg lavede, da den blev designet, tvang mig til at tage en pause fra den. Jeg tog mine sko på og gik udenfor. Det viste sig at være koldt, så jeg
Online Weather Station (NodeMCU): 7 trin (med billeder)
![Online Weather Station (NodeMCU): 7 trin (med billeder) Online Weather Station (NodeMCU): 7 trin (med billeder)](https://i.howwhatproduce.com/images/002/image-5422-15-j.webp)
Online Weather Station (NodeMCU): Hej fyre! Jeg håber, at du allerede nød min tidligere instruerbare " Arduino Robot 4WR " og du er klar til en ny, som sædvanlig lavede jeg denne vejledning til at guide dig trin for trin, mens du laver dit eget elektroniske projekt. Under fremstillingen af dette
Lav et online Fish Tank Webcam !: 8 trin (med billeder)
![Lav et online Fish Tank Webcam !: 8 trin (med billeder) Lav et online Fish Tank Webcam !: 8 trin (med billeder)](https://i.howwhatproduce.com/images/003/image-6230-j.webp)
Oprettelse af et online fisketank -webcam !: Trin for trin vejledning til modding af et IP -kamera, så det kan tilsluttes direkte til en akvarium. Grunden til at dette er nødvendigt, er fordi webcams normalt er designet til at blive sat foran motivet eller har brug for et stativ. Dog med en Fish Ta
Online Weather Display Widget Brug af ESP8266: 4 trin
![Online Weather Display Widget Brug af ESP8266: 4 trin Online Weather Display Widget Brug af ESP8266: 4 trin](https://i.howwhatproduce.com/images/005/image-14058-j.webp)
Online Weather Display Widget Ved hjælp af ESP8266: For et par uger siden lærte vi, hvordan man bygger et online vejrvisningssystem, der indhentede vejrinformation for en bestemt by og viste det på et OLED -modul. Vi brugte Arduino Nano 33 IoT -kortet til det projekt, som er et nyt bord til
Lær, hvordan du designer et brugerdefineret formet printkort med EasyEDA Online -værktøjer: 12 trin (med billeder)
![Lær, hvordan du designer et brugerdefineret formet printkort med EasyEDA Online -værktøjer: 12 trin (med billeder) Lær, hvordan du designer et brugerdefineret formet printkort med EasyEDA Online -værktøjer: 12 trin (med billeder)](https://i.howwhatproduce.com/images/006/image-15416-j.webp)
Lær, hvordan du designer et brugerdefineret PCB med EasyEDA Online Tools: Jeg har altid ønsket at designe et brugerdefineret printkort, og med online værktøjer og billige PCB -prototyper har det aldrig været lettere end nu! Det er endda muligt at få overflademonteringskomponenterne samlet billigt og let i lille volumen for at spare den vanskelige sol